Re: 1980 115 Tilt and Trim

What colour wires are coming directly off the trim motor?

In reference to your unit leaking down, do both the trim and tilt leak down, or just the tilt? If they both leak down I would first look at the manual release screw and o ring. Also check the trim pistons and sleeves (o rings). If just the tilt leaks, it is likely an internal problem with a valve or a leaky tilt cylinder line or tilt cylinder valve.
